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Tilda Swinton
Photo #1231127
Tilda Swinton - photo #231
3500x2333
3120x2089
3500x2334
Tilda Swinton photo #1231127 (231 of 323)
Added: 2020-09-09 00:00:00
Size: 3120x2089 px (0 Kb)
Tilda Swinton
323
More Tilda Swinton photos
3280x4928
1000x1500
1
1000x1255
2
1453x1938
View all Tilda Swinton photos (323)